Nifurtimox, an antiprotozoal agent, which is generally used for the treatment of infections with Trypanosoma cruzi, has been used in the therapy of neuroblastoma. Nifurtimox affects enzyme activity of lactate dehydrogenase (LDH).

Nifurtimox affects enzyme activity of lactate dehydrogenase (LDH). To differentiate if this effect is a result of a reduced LDH activity or a shift in pyruvate metabolism due to activation of PDH, the enzyme activity of LDH is determined after 4 h treatment with 50 µg/mL Nifurtimox. Compared to the untreated control, the LDH activity is significantly reduced for LA-N-1 (P=0.005), IMR-32 (P=0.009), LS (P=0.0035) and SK-N-SH (P=0.0065). Nifurtimox reduces cell viability and induces cell cycle arrest and apoptosis in neuroblastoma cells. To characterize the cytotoxic impacts of Nifurtimox on neuroblastoma, 4 cell lines are subjected to several experiments. Cell viability is reduced for all 4 neuroblastoma cell lines after 24 h incubation with 50 µg/mL to an average of 66%, 63%, 62% and 75% (LA-N-1, IMR-32 LS and SK-N-SH, respectively). The reduction is significant compared to the untreated control (P<0.01) and the vehicle control with DMSO (P<0.05) for all cell lines[1].
